Mechatronics Certificate of Achievement
Mechatronics Certificate of Achievement
at Mission College
San Jose Catalog
Mechatronic technology is an interdisciplinary field that combines the study of mechanics, electronics, automation, and computers. Certificate of Achievement in Mechatronic Technology prepares students to work in various industries. Depending on the course track selected, students gain specialized technical skills in electrical, electronic and/or mechanical industry environment. Career/Transfer Opportunities: Career opportunities include the following: robotics technician, field service technician, industrial maintenance technician, engineering technician, electromechanical technician, research and development technician.
